Hand of Fate 2 is a dungeon crawler set in a world of dark fantasy. Master a living boardgame where every stage of the adventure is drawn from a deck of legendary encounters chosen by you! Choose wisely - your opponent, the enigmatic Dealer, will pull no punches as he shapes you into the instrument of his revenge. The table has changed, but the stakes remain the same: life or death! KEY GAME FEATURES A world transformed - 100 years have passed since the Dealer was usurped and the Game of Life and Death gained a new master. 22 exciting new challenges that will push your deck-building skills to the limit - Hunt fiendish assassins, reunite star-crossed lovers or build up a fortress to withstand a raider assault! Enlist the aid of all new companion characters - team up with them in battle, or have them bend the rules of the boardgame in your favor! Hundreds of new encounters, artifacts and items to earn and upgrade. Enhanced action-RPG combat - shred foes with quick dual-wielded daggers or brutalize them with heavy two-handed hammers. Build up your combo meter to unleash powerful special attacks! Engage new foes united by all-new card suits - Cross swords with disciplined Imperial soldiers, purge corrupted mutants and fend off northern raiders.
What it’s like
Hand of Fate 2 delivers a unique fusion of deck-building strategy and third-person action RPG combat. You play as an unnamed hero navigating a dark fantasy world controlled by the enigmatic Dealer, who manipulates reality through cards to create dynamic encounters. The core loop involves selecting cards that dictate your path, enemies, and rewards, creating a highly replayable experience where no two runs feel identical. The tone is gritty and atmospheric, emphasizing high stakes and survival against overwhelming odds. While the narrative serves as a framework for the gameplay, the true depth lies in building synergistic decks and mastering combat mechanics. The game excels in its innovative structure, blending turn-based decision-making with real-time action, resulting in a tense, engaging, and mechanically rich dungeon crawler that rewards strategic planning and adaptability.

Keep in mind Combat, while improved from the first game, remains somewhat shallow and repetitive for players seeking deep melee mechanics. · The narrative is minimal and episodic; those looking for a profound, character-driven story may find it lacking.
